Publisher Description
A woman is found dead in her room at the care home she lived in, strangled and left lying on her Chinese rug. The death is motiveless, the room otherwise untouched, expensive objects left unstolen; meanwhile, even the fellow residents admit their friend's life was largely a mystery to them, with "decades left unaccounted for".
Investigating the crime, detectives discover a whole alternative history of their town; a history that takes in rivalries, crimes, social upheaval, family heartbreak; and ultimately offers the solution to the mystery they are facing.
